Are Boggers road legal?

Are Boggers road legal?

Boggers are extremely versatile D.O.T. approved and street legal, and can easily be modified and custom grooved for cut, open, and pro stock classes.

What brand are Boggers?

Interco has taken the Bogger’s unmatched performance and unmistakable styling and put it into the Bogger UTV tire. The Bogger UTV Tire incorporates Interco’s patented Three Stage Lug (TSL) Technology which help make it an aggressive work horse.

Are Boggers good on road?

Beyond mud, this tire excels on dirt, sand and rock as well. Despite being street legal and DOT approved, you can take one look at this tire and know that it is not going to ride well on the street. Overall, the Super Swamper TSL Bogger is the closest you can get to the perfect mud tire.

Are super swamper Boggers good on the road?

To sum it up- the Bogger is a great off-road/mud tire but that’s it. If you plan on driving the Boggers on the street, make sure you really want them and have good insurance if you drive on narrow streets. The Swamper Radials aren’t as aggressive but still do well off-road and are well street mannered.

Who Makes Ground Hawg?

Interco Tire Corporation, is a Louisiana company that has evolved through three generations into a leader in the development of high performance tires for use on four wheel drive light trucks and all terrain vehicles.

How many miles can you get out of Boggers?

With a 33″ bogger that you’re on the road with, you can MAYBE expect 15k out of them, if you rotate & check pressure religiously…

Are Boggers good for daily driving?

Boggers are probably the worst tire for a daily driver. This is why Interco makes Thornbirds.

Are TSL Super Swampers directional?

Super Swamper TSL Boggers were engineered with the professional mud bogger in mind. Boggers feature a directional tread pattern with the patented Interco TSL (three stage lug) design.

What kind of tire is a bogger tire?

Boggers are bias tires and come in over 55 various wheel size width configurations including the B/RC-17 – 42.5×13.50-17 competition / off-road use only, non-DOT approved “sticky”. Please note that Bogger tread patterns (slightly) vary by size.
